According to Sky Sport, Inter and Roma are locked in active transfer negotiations regarding Brazilian forward Luis Henrique, with the capital club pursuing the 2001-born player as the Nerazzurri set an evaluation just under 30 million euros. The proposed sale aims to fund Inter’s final incoming targets before the transfer window closes, though the deal ultimately hinges on the player’s personal approval of a move to manager Gian Piero Gasperini’s squad.
Transfer Negotiations and Financial Valuation
Talks between Inter and Roma intensified following an initial approach, according to reporting from Sky Sport. The Nerazzurri are willing to sanction a permanent departure for the former Marseille player to generate funds for late-window reinforcements. While a basic financial agreement sits just below the 30-million-euro threshold, additional interest from Premier League sides has also materialized, as noted by Sky Sport Italia. Roma values the versatile attacker not only for the wide channels but also for his ability to operate effectively directly behind the central striker.
Squad Adjustments and Roma’s Market Activity
For Roma, the pursuit of Luis Henrique coincides with other major defensive acquisitions. According to Sky Sport, the Giallorossi have reached a full agreement with Atletico Madrid for lateral defender Nahuel Molina at 13 million euros plus 4 million in add-ons. Molina is set to join on a permanent transfer and will occupy a non-foreign squad slot after completing his Spanish passport paperwork. Manager Gian Piero Gasperini has pressed club management for significant roster investment, making Champions League qualification a key selling point in convincing targets like Luis Henrique to move to the Stadio Olimpico.

Davide Frattesi Nears Lazio Switch
In a separate departure from San Siro, midfielder Davide Frattesi is closing in on a transfer to Lazio. According to Sky Sport, the former Sassuolo player is set to join the Biancocelesti on an initial loan featuring a conditional obligation to buy tied to team performance benchmarks. The deal structure also incorporates a future resale percentage clause in Inter’s favor. Frattesi struggled for consistent playing time under successive managers, prompting the ongoing efforts to finalize his exit before the end of the week.
